SpringBoot項目整合Log4j2實現(xiàn)自定義日志打印失效問題解決
主要的原因是因為,SpringBoot的logback包的存在,會導致Spring Boot項目優(yōu)先實現(xiàn)logback的日志設置,所以導致我們用Log4j2實現(xiàn)自定義日志失效。
先找l哪個包引用了logback包

進入之后查詢logback

然后雙擊包

發(fā)現(xiàn)是spring-boot-starter-logging包
再依次查詢,最后得到
logback --> spring-boot-starter-logging --> spring-boot-starter --> spring-boot-starter-jdbc
--> xxx.pom(自己的pom文件)
最后在該包下面剔除logging包即可
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-jdbc</artifactId>
<exclusions>
<exclusion>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-logging</artifactId>
</exclusion>
</exclusions>
</dependency>到此這篇關于關于SpringBoot項目整合Log4j2實現(xiàn)自定義日志打印失效原因的文章就介紹到這了,更多相關SpringBoot整合Log4j2內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關文章希望大家以后多多支持腳本之家!
相關文章
springboot中RestTemplate配置HttpClient連接池詳解
這篇文章主要介紹了springboot中RestTemplate配置HttpClient連接池詳解,這些Http連接工具,使用起來都比較復雜,如果項目中使用的是Spring框架,可以使用Spring自帶的RestTemplate來進行Http連接請求,需要的朋友可以參考下2023-11-11
springcloud如何用Redlock實現(xiàn)分布式鎖
本文主要介紹了springcloud如何用Redlock實現(xiàn)分布式鎖,文中通過示例代碼介紹的非常詳細,具有一定的參考價值,感興趣的小伙伴們可以參考一下2021-11-11
詳解關于springboot-actuator監(jiān)控的401無權限訪問
本篇文章主要介紹了詳解關于springboot-actuator監(jiān)控的401無權限訪問,非常具有實用價值,有興趣的可以了解一下2017-09-09
SpringCloud創(chuàng)建多模塊項目的實現(xiàn)示例
,Spring Cloud作為一個強大的微服務框架,提供了豐富的功能和組件,本文主要介紹了SpringCloud創(chuàng)建多模塊項目的實現(xiàn)示例,具有一定的參考價值,感興趣的可以了解一下2024-02-02
Java使用DFA算法實現(xiàn)過濾多家公司自定義敏感字功能詳解
這篇文章主要介紹了Java使用DFA算法實現(xiàn)過濾多家公司自定義敏感字功能,結合實例形式分析了DFA算法的實現(xiàn)原理及過濾敏感字的相關操作技巧,需要的朋友可以參考下2017-08-08

